Diaper Rash or Diaper Dermatitis is a red rash that appears on the buttocks and groin area of the baby. The rash is inflamed and may have seeping eruptions if severe. It is found in children under age 2 years, and most ordinarily in the middle of ages 9-12 months. It causes a lot of hurt to the baby, especially when the diapers are soiled or wet, and also when the area is cleaned during a diaper change.

The main factor causing the rash is wetness due to urine and feces, but it can also be caused by detergents and chemicals in the diapers, other infections such as monilia (thrush), immoderate washing of the skin with soap, and the use of plastic pants that exaserbate the wetness.  
 
It is very important to convert the diaper as soon as it becomes soiled or wet, and to wash the area wholly and to dry it very well with each diaper change. Gently pat the area dry, or use a hair dryer to preclude further irritation to the area. In fact, it is a good idea to leave the diaper off wholly and let your baby air dry for a short time spans each day, more often if the rash is severe. 
 
Avoid powders that can cake to the skin, and mineral oil, which can clog the pores.   Do not use plastic pants or disposable diapers, which discourage air circulation. 
 
If you use cloth diapers, you can add vinegar to the rinse water, or use a borax soap to neutralize the ammonia that is produced by the urine. Be sure to clean the diapering area frequently. A mild vinegar explication is good for this: 1 part vinegar to four parts water. 
 
You can make your own natural baby powder. A recipe I have found helpful is to put ½ cup of cornstarch in a baggy, and then add nearby 20 drops of therapeutic grade lavender principal oil (Lavendula agustafolia) evenly throughout the cornstarch (to preclude clumping). Then close the baggy and use your fingers to disperse the oil throughout the cornstarch. You can then use a salt shaker with large holes to dispense the powder. This is a wonderful, therapeutic powder to apply during diaper changes. Another recipe would be to add 20 drops of Roman Chamomile (Charmaemelum nobile) to the cornstarch, or you could add 10 drops of lavender and 10 drops of Roman Chamomile. 
 
Another aromatherapy recipe for treatment would be to make a therapeutic lotion by adding 5 drops of lavender and 2 drops of Roman Chamomile to ½ ounce of calendula-infused oil (preferably) or jojoba carrier oil. Blend this thoroughly, and then apply a few drops during diaper changes after the baby has been cleaned, and dried, and before applying the clean diaper
 
See your pediatrician if the diaper rash doesn't improve in a consolidate of weeks.

Diaper cakes are a unique way to provide parents-to-be with a much needed baby item. Regardless of whether this is their first child or third child, diapers are all the time needed. Newborns can go straight through in any place from 8-12 diapers per day. Instead of bringing a box or container of diapers with you to the baby shower bring a diaper cake. This is a astonishing way to gift a practical baby item.

Many diaper cakes are made from original disposable diapers. However, with the trend of parents wanting to go whether natural or organic there are now cakes made from non-chlorinated diapers or cloth diapers. You can have your option of a uncomplicated cake made only of diapers or something more detailed. The more detailed diaper cakes will have needed baby items, such as blankets, rattles, lotions, washcloths and pacifiers. The only issue with this is that you want to know what parents-to-be will be using. You don't want to buy a diaper cake, or any baby gift, with baby toiletries only to find out the parents want to use all natural products or organic products.

There are a few ways to buy a baby shower cake. First, you can go find a specialty store. Many card market or specialty baby boutiques will now carry a variety of cakes. These cakes are ordinarily made by local crafters.

Second, you can purchase your diaper cake online. The internet allows you to do comparison shopping to find different designs and prices. You will get an idea of what themes are available as well as what types and brands of diapers are used. There are many citizen who will sell their cakes on auction sites, like eBay, as well as businesses who dedicate their websites to baby diaper cakes as well as other shower products.

The last way to get an adorable shower cake is to make one yourself. You can find directions online. There are also how to videos that will show you exactly how to make one.

Regardless of you find your baby diaper cake parents-to-be will authentically appreciate this much needed gift.
